Until the end of 2023, the minimum pension in Ukraine will be 2,093 UAH. The minimum pension for seniors with full work experience is 2,760 hryvnia. However, age reduction will be given to retirees who are 70, 75 and 80 years old.
Additions to the pension
The Seniors Supplementary Pension Plan is valid for one year. Seniors will receive additional money in the following amount:
- 300 hryvnia – pensioners from 70 to 75 years old;
- 456 hryvnia – retirees from 75 to 80 years old;
- 570 hryvnia – pensioners over 80 years old.
UN pension supplements
Taras Melnichuk, Permanent Representative of the Council of Ministers in the Verkhovna Rada, said that there are retirees who are internally displaced from the regions of hostilities, whose pension payments are less than 3,000 hryvnia per month and do not receive additional cash. Payments from international organizations from 1 March 2023. The amount of the financial assistance will be determined as the difference between the pension and UAH 3,000, but cannot be less than UAH 100.
To receive assistance, you must fill out an application form on the eDopomoga information platform.
